What drives the LINK sentiment score?
Our AI classifier reads every article that mentions LINK and scores it bullish, bearish, or neutral based on the language and framing. Importance weighting ensures that a major publication’s regulatory announcement carries more weight than a small-outlet price recap. The aggregate is then normalised to the 0-100 index you see above.
Typical drivers for Chainlink include: regulatory news (particularly around the SEC and major jurisdictions), ETF flow announcements, protocol upgrades, macro surprises that move all risk assets, exchange activity (listings, delistings, hacks), and partnerships with large brands or institutions.
How to use LINK sentiment in trading
- Extreme readings are actionable. Below 20 has historically been a contrarian buy zone for LINK; above 80 has historically been a contrarian sell zone.
- Divergence with price is a powerful signal. When LINK makes a new high but sentiment fails to, the rally is stretched. Inverse applies for new lows.
- Use the market-wide score as a regime filter. LINK-specific readings amplify or dampen relative to the overall market mood.
